Chemically, Ascorbyl Palmitate is a derivative of L-ascorbic acid, where a palmitoyl group (derived from palmitic acid, a saturated fatty acid) is esterified at the 6-hydroxyl position of the ascorbic acid molecule. This structure results in an amphipathic molecule, meaning it possesses both hydrophilic (water-loving, from the ascorbic acid part) and lipophilic (fat-loving, from the palmitic acid part) characteristics. However, its overall solubility profile leans towards lipophilicity, making it soluble in oils, fats, and organic solvents like alcohol, while being largely insoluble in water.

The synthesis of Ascorbyl Palmitate can be achieved through several methods. A common approach involves the direct esterification of ascorbic acid with palmitic acid or its derivatives, often catalyzed by acids or enzymes. For example, ascorbic acid can react with palmitoyl chloride. Enzymatic synthesis, using lipases, offers a potentially greener and more specific route, often conducted in organic solvents at controlled temperatures. These processes yield Ascorbyl Palmitate typically as a white to yellowish-white powder with a molecular weight of approximately 414.54 g/mol and a purity often exceeding 95%.

The molecular structure of Ascorbyl Palmitate dictates its primary functions. Its ascorbic acid component provides antioxidant activity, acting as a radical scavenger. The palmitic acid chain enhances its solubility in lipids, allowing it to integrate into cell membranes and lipophilic environments. This dual nature makes it exceptionally effective in protecting sensitive lipids from oxidation and in stabilizing formulations containing oils and fat-soluble vitamins. Its stability compared to pure ascorbic acid is a significant advantage in applications requiring long shelf-life.

The applications of Ascorbyl Palmitate span across industries due to these properties. In the food sector, it serves as an antioxidant and preservative. In cosmetics, it functions as a skincare active ingredient and antioxidant, benefiting products aimed at anti-aging and skin brightening. In pharmaceuticals, its stability and antioxidant properties are leveraged in various formulations.
